AYANEO Pocket Micro Classic
AYANEO · Released Mar 2025 ·
The AYANEO Pocket Micro Classic is a 3.5" IPS handheld from AYANEO powered by the MediaTek Helio G99. It launched at around $175.
Pros
- +Premium-feeling metal body
- +Ease of access to Android games and apps
- +Ideal 3:2 aspect ratio for Game Boy Advance
- +The touchscreen is useful for navigation and touch/stylus-based games
- +Fast and responsive navigation thanks to 6 GB of RAM
Cons
- −No analog sticks, which reduces compatibility with some systems
- −Great emulation performance, but the screen size isn't ideal for widescreen games
- −No headphone jack
- −Can't be connected to external monitors

Full specifications
Hardware
- Chipset (SoC)
- MediaTek Helio G99
- CPU
- Cortex-A76, 8 cores, 2.0 GHz - 2.2 GHz
- GPU
- Mali-G57 MC2, 600 - 950 MHz
- RAM
- 6 GB LPDDR4X
- Storage
- 128GB Internal
- Weight
- 227 g
- Dimensions
- 156 x 63 x 18 mm
- Cooling
- Active (fan)
Display
- Size
- 3.5″
- Resolution
- 960 x 640
- Panel
- IPS
- Refresh rate
- 60 Hz
- Touchscreen
- Yes
Battery & Connectivity
- Battery
- 2600 mAh

- Wi-Fi
- Wi-Fi 5
- Bluetooth
- Bluetooth 5.2
- Ports
- USB-C, microSD
- Expandable storage
- Yes (microSD)
Controls
- Analog sticks
- 0
- D-pad
- Yes
- Face buttons
- Yes
- Analog triggers
- No
- Gyroscope
- Yes
- Hall effect sticks
- No
Software & custom firmware
Ships with: Android 13
Also plays natively: Android
